Technical Analysis

From a technical standpoint, BIPC is currently trading between two well-defined near-term price levels: immediate support at $38.39 and immediate resistance at $42.43. The $38.39 support level has held during three separate pullbacks in recent weeks, acting as a reliable floor for the stock during bouts of broader market selling. The $42.43 resistance level marks a recent swing high that the stock has tested twice in the past month, failing to close above that level on both attempts. BIPC’s relative strength index (RSI) is currently in the neutral range, showing no signs of extreme overbought or oversold conditions, which suggests there is no immediate technical pressure for a sharp price reversion. The stock is also trading between its short-term and medium-term moving averages, indicating a lack of strong established near-term trend, with price action largely range-bound over the past several weeks.
